WBC 8.8! All looks good for discharge tomorrow. I was partly right, Peter had alot packed and knew pretty much where everything else would go. Almost all of his meds are by mouth now and he only has one bag hanging. Maybe he won't have to come home with a pump.
I'll get training tomorrow on changing his bandage on the port. They will review with both of us his meds and any possible interactions - timing on some of them is crucial. Don't know how many pills there will be yet plus mouthwashes, creams and who knows what else.
We talked with his nurse today and she said since he got stem cells from cord blood he is basically a baby as far as his immune system is concerned - so we treat him like a baby as far as being near illnesses is concerned. Eventually he will have to get all his vaccinations again.
He can come with me to get groceries or to a movie or when he is eating more, we can go out to eat - just need to be sure we go at the least crowded times. We specifically asked about going to church on 12/9 and she said no way. Oh well, there is always next year.
I gave the front desk a list of what needed to be done for cleaning tomorrow and I will doublecheck with the manager in the morning to be sure there is no problem. The place just needs a good cleaning and the kitchen and bathrooms need to be cleaned with antibacterial stuff. Wanted the filters changed too. Don't want to take any chances.
